Green Chick Pea Goodness from Fresh Nature

By Lorrie Baumann

Fresh Nature is ready to introduce Americans to bright green hummus and falafel. Founded in 2012, the brand offers a line of products made from green chick peas. The line includes frozen Falafel Cakes and Southwestern Cakes that make a convenient meal option, hummus in four flavors and snack packs with mini-chick pea cakes and a sauce in which to dip them.

The snack packs are offered in two flavors – Spicy Cakes that come with four cakes and 2 ounces of a tangy chipotle dip and Falafel Cakes that come with four cakes and two ounces of a creamy tahini dip. They’re both vegan, and the four-cake package is enough for a hearty snack or a light lunch. They’ll retail for $4.99.

The Fresh Nature Falafel Cakes and Southwestern Cakes are offered in packages of eight for the freezer case. Each cake is a serving for a convenient plant-based entree that can be prepared for the table in a microwave oven, on the stovetop or in a conventional oven. They cook from frozen in just 60 seconds in the microwave, although the conventional oven will bring out extra flavor in 10 to 12 minutes of cooking time. Because the chick pea cakes are made from the young green chick peas, they’re moister than traditional falafel made from mature dried chick peas.

There are four flavors of Fresh Nature Hummus: Classic, Falafel, Roasted Garlic and Jalapeno. Eight-ounce tubs retail for $3.99 to $4.99. Because the hummus is made from green chick peas rather than dried mature chick peas, it’s not just bright green – it’s also creamier and has a fresher taste than traditional hummus.

The green chick peas in the products are sourced from farms owned by Fresh Nature and 15 other family farms in southeastern Washington and northeastern Oregon. Ryan Davenport is Fresh Nature’s President. His farm has been in his family for four generations, and Davenport himself returned to the farm in 2010 after spending time away. The farm began planting chick peas as a rotation crop in wheat fields to provide a natural source of nitrogen to help replace nutrients depleted by nitrogen-hungry wheat. “It was all about trying to keep hold of our sustainable farm practices,” he said.

That was before hummus had exploded in popularity in the American market, and it wasn’t easy to turn chick peas into a profitable crop, so the company started work to develop marketable products for its chick peas. From the early to mid-2000s, Davenport’s family farm was working on how to harvest and preserve green chick peas. Once that process was dialed in, the family launched Fresh Nature to introduce its green chick pea products into a market that had discovered chick peas as a tasty source of plant protein. “We’re finding that more and more of our customers are wanting plant-based, organic and all-natural foods,” Davenport said. “So many people are looking for protein.”

Healthy Snacking from Highland Farm Foods #GNatSFFS

Snacking healthy and following a healthier lifestyle should not be a dull experience. In fact, it should be fun, enjoyable and guilt free! For Highland Farm Foods, it’s all about snacking on real food with real flavors. The company believes in making healthy, nutritious and delicious products with natural ingredients and no artificial flavors. Its new savory line comes in three innovative flavors: Black Sea Salt, Sweet Chili and Italian Herbs. Indulge in its fun sized snacks while you’re on the go, at work, class, or watching a movie.

For the new savory line, Highland Farm Foods focused on researching original and innovative ingredients in order to develop fun and exciting flavors.

Black Sea Salt will stand out from any other sea salt snack you have ever tasted. Highland Farm Foods went to Peru to the ancient Inca valleys to find black sea salt, which is found in small ponds that were part of an ocean that evaporated thousands of years ago. In today’s age, indigenous farmers (descendants of the Incas) are the only ones who can harvest this black sea salt. Black sea salt’s flavor is so unique that Highland Farm Foods decided to use it in all its savory flavors.

Sweet Chili was inspired by Thai sweet and savory combinations. Highland Farm Foods decided to mix together some key ingredients that would create a balanced snack with a subtle spicy kick. If you are a fan of exotic flavors, Sweet Chili is for you.

Italian Herbs was inspired by Italian flavors. This flavorful snack is great to eat on the go, or as a topping on avocado toasts, or instead of croutons in a salad.

Lantana Foods Delivers Hummus for Breakfast

By Lorrie Baumann

With its first hummus launched in just 2011, Lantana Hummus has become one of the top brands in the category by turning the whole definition of the product on its head.

Everyone knows what hummus is, but for those who need a dictionary definition, Merriam-Webster provides one. By that definition, hummus is “a paste of pureed chickpeas usually mixed with sesame oil or sesame paste and eaten as a dip or sandwich spread.”

To which, the three foodie friends who founded Lantana Hummus, all with a background of working for some of the larger producers in the space, said something like, “A pulse is a pulse. A bean is a bean,” according to Matt Gase, CEO of Lantana Foods since 2016. “What’s sacred about the garbanzo bean? … Let’s create something that is culinary, something that is fun and bright and flavorful.”

And from that thought, they created a line of hummus that uses beans other than chickpeas, and they exercised culinary ingenuity on additions of vegetables and toppings. “Every one of their SKUs is like its own creation — it’s not just the same hummus coming off the line with a different topping on it,” Gase said.

Sriracha Carrot is a top seller that offers the color and sweetness of carrots and the zing of sriracha in a white bean hummus that’s topped with sunflower seeds and dried apricots. White Bean Hummus has a topping of pine nuts and herbs, and Cucumber is a hummus made from white beans and edamame and topped with cucumber and dill.
The three newest flavors, launching this year, are Hatch Chile, Cauliflower, and Strawberry. They each start with a white bean hummus base. Hatch Chile is made with New Mexico Hatch chiles and topped with diced green chiles. The Cauliflower Hummus offers cauliflower blended in the hummus and pickled carrots, cauliflower bits and caramelized onions as a topping.

That brings us to Strawberry, which was born out of market intelligence that informed its creators that consumers were using Lantana’s Black Bean Hummus as an ingredient in breakfast burritos. If consumers want to eat hummus for breakfast, why would it have to be savory? “We’d had such success introducing vegetables into our hummus, why not fruit? Can we pull it off?” Gase explained the thinking.

The result is a Strawberry Hummus, with some basil for an herbal counterbalance to the sweetness and a topping of strawberries, basil and balsamic vinegar. The company’s market research says that consumers are interested in using it as a replacement for cream cheese. “We’ve had feedback that people are replacing jelly in a peanut butter and hummus sandwich — sort of a protein bomb there,” Gase said.

Following the success of Strawberry, Lantana Hummus is rolling out other fruit-forward hummus concoctions with white bean bases this summer. Blueberry hummus is made with white bean hummus topped with hibiscus, mint and dried blueberries. Cherry has sweet cherries and a topping of sweet and smoked cherries and sunflower seeds. Mango includes cilantro in the base and a topping of chile lime mango and pineapple.

All of the Lantana Hummus products are gluten free and vegan friendly, and most are non-GMO. The 10-ounce tubs retail for around $4.49.
